The Renaissance Revolution: When Art and Science Collided

The Renaissance was more than just a cultural awakening — it was a revolution that bridged art, science, and human curiosity. Emerging in Europe between the 14th and 17th centuries, this era redefined how people viewed the world and themselves. Artists became scientists, and scientists became artists, blending creativity with inquiry. The result was an explosion of innovation that transformed philosophy, architecture, anatomy, and astronomy, laying the foundation for the modern age.

A New Way of Seeing the World

Before the Renaissance, much of Europe’s knowledge and expression were shaped by religion and tradition. But as scholars rediscovered classical Greek and Roman works, humanism emerged — a philosophy that placed man, not God, at the center of thought. This shift inspired artists and thinkers to explore the natural world through observation and experimentation. Paintings began to reflect depth, proportion, and realism, mirroring scientific precision.

Leonardo da Vinci: The Perfect Fusion of Art and Science

No figure captures the Renaissance spirit better than Leonardo da Vinci. He was not just a painter but an inventor, engineer, and anatomist. His notebooks are filled with sketches of flying machines, human organs, and mathematical patterns — all drawn with artistic beauty and scientific accuracy. His masterpiece, Vitruvian Man, perfectly symbolizes the era’s pursuit of balance between art and empirical knowledge. For Leonardo, creativity and curiosity were inseparable forces driving human progress.

Science Finds Its Voice

The Renaissance also marked the birth of modern science. Visionaries like Galileo Galilei, Nicolaus Copernicus, and Andreas Vesalius challenged long-held beliefs about the universe and the human body. Through observation and evidence, they replaced dogma with discovery. Galileo’s telescopic studies of the planets and Vesalius’s anatomical drawings redefined truth through visual and mathematical proof — merging artistry with precision.

Art as a Reflection of Scientific Discovery

The advancements in science influenced art in profound ways. The study of optics and geometry led to linear perspective, giving paintings a sense of depth and realism never seen before. Artists like Michelangelo and Raphael combined anatomical accuracy with divine emotion, making their works both spiritual and scientific. Architecture, too, embraced proportion and symmetry, echoing mathematical harmony in cathedrals and domes.

Conclusion

The Renaissance revolution was a celebration of curiosity — a time when imagination met intellect. It proved that art and science are not rivals but partners in understanding the world. By blending creativity with inquiry, Renaissance thinkers set humanity on a path of innovation that continues to shape culture, knowledge, and discovery today.
